软考
APP下载

连续存储有哪些方式

随着计算机技术的不断发展,存储技术也随之不断更新。其中连续存储作为常见的一种存储方式,广泛应用于各种领域。本篇文章将从不同的角度分析连续存储的方式,以便更好地了解其特点与应用。

一、 磁盘存储

磁盘存储是一种以互联的磁盘为基础的连续存储方式。对于大型的文件,磁盘存储可以分割文件存储到若干个块中,而每个块都可以被单独访问。在磁盘存储中,块是一个很重要的概念,因为它被用于记录文件在磁盘上存储的位置信息。通过这种方式,磁盘存储可以更加高效地管理文件,并提高数据的读取速度。

二、 数组存储

数组存储是指将数据存储在连续的内存单元中。这种存储方式最常用于保存简单的数据类型,如整数、字符和浮点数等。在数组存储中,每个元素都被存储在相邻的内存单元中,因此可以通过下标来访问特定的元素。数组存储的优点是:可以快速访问数据,而且对于数据的处理也更加方便。但是,数组存储也具有缺点,例如在删除元素时需要移动后续元素的位置。

三、 链表存储

链表存储是一种将数据存储在不连续的内存单元中的方式。在链表中,每个节点都包含了数据和指向下一个节点的指针。通过这种方式,链表可以非常高效地插入和删除数据,而不需要移动其他节点。此外,链表存储还可以在需要时动态地分配内存,因此可以避免浪费空间的问题。

四、 树形存储

树形存储是一种将数据存储在树形结构中的连续存储方式。在树形存储中,每个节点都包含了数据和指向其子节点的指针。通过这种方式,树形存储可以快速的搜索和插入数据,并且可以高效地处理大量的数据。

综上所述,连续存储有多种方式,每种方式都有自己的特点与应用。通过选择适合的连续存储方式,可以更加高效地管理和处理数据。

备考资料 免费领取:软件设计师报考指南+考情分析+思维导图等 立即下载
真题演练 精准解析历年真题,助你高效备考! 立即做题
相关阅读
软件设计师题库